A Thermal Type Flow Meter for Low Flow Rates of Anhydrous Hydrofluoric Acid

Description: Report discussing a thermal type flow meter which was adapted for metering anydrous hydrofluoric acid at low flow rates. Corrosive gases, which are not appropriate for handling in standard type rotameters or orifice meters, are also suitable for this thermal type flow meter.

Distribution-Free Tolerance Limits

Description: A method is reviewed for settling a limit such that the probability is a that at least the proportion beta of future observations will be greater than or less than this limit. The method has great generality because no assumptions except continuity are necessary in to the form of the underlying distributions. The method may be used to establish reliability of a component when sufficient numbers of the component are measured.
